MEMORANDUM FOR: WAOCC Members
28 November 1983
FROM : David V. McManis
National Intelligence Officer for Warning
SUBJECT : Washington Area Operations/Intelligence
Centers (WAOCC) Conference, 10 Nov 83
1. The WAOCC metl on 10 November 1983 and received an
outstanding orientation and superb hospitality from our hosts. Special thanks
are due to The agenda is at Attachment 1.
2., The Conference observed the Current Requirements Working Group as it
developed special emphasis priorities and gained an appreciation of the
community integration in the procedure.
3. During a discussion of near-real-time exploitation and reporting
operations, solicited NIO/Warning support and recommendations 25X1
for the ongoing Indications and Working Group Collection Strategies. As a
result, NIO/Warning and NWS staffs are reviewing the collection methodologies,
critical problem statements, and targeting selections to ensure warning
emphases are consistent with the broadened warning goals described by the
DCI. NIO/W will elicit additional support from the National Intelligence
Council (NIC) as required.

5. Mr. McManis proposed to host a symposium on Crisis Management to
discuss practical operations/intelligence center problems related to
information flow and communications. The members agreed on the utility of the
idea. NIO/W office will develop three scenarios and a discussion plan and
host the one-day symposium during the April WAOCC 25X1
meeting. In addition to the usual participants, representatives from FEMA,
FBI, and DOE will be invited to attend the symposium.
6. Reporting on the ongoing WAOCC training initiative, NIO/W proposed an
Executive Team Building Seminar, emphasizing individual and group perceptions,
group decision making, communications in crisis situations and problem
solving. Tentatively the seminar is scheduled for 22, 23, and 24
February 1984. Funding aspects are being worked by NIO/W and nominations for
attendance will be solicited in the near future.
7. Mr. McManis also announced his intention to produce a training
videotape that orients persons to Washington Area Operations/Intelligence
Centers. The need for such a training product has been voiced by WAOCC
members, Defense Intelligence College, and Command J-2's and their
representatives. Members pledged their support.
8. The next WAOCC meeting will be at 0900 hours on 27 January 84, hosted
by Mr. Art Long of the Department of the Treasury. As discussed, FEMA will be
invited to become a member of Vie 4A000 as of the.Jan 84 meeting.
